Green beer may be a creature of the macrobrew culture, but that isn’t stopping some craft breweries from getting in on the St. Paddy’s Day action.

Orlison distributed kegs of colored Clem’s Gold to the South Hill Growler Guys, Havanuther light pilsner to the Post Street Ale House and Pilsner 37 to Silver Mountain Resort.

Paragon in Coeur d’Alene is serving a greened Galena Gold from Boise’s Sockeye Brewing, while in Post Falls, Downdraft is pouring a tinted Project Pale upon request.

And in Sandpoint, both MickDuff’s (which sounds vaguely Gaelic) and Laughing Dog are offering emerald versions of their own creations.
